Why Choose a Jon Boat with a Console?
Jon boats, traditionally flat-bottomed and open, are simple in design but highly functional. Adding a console changes the game by offering several advantages:
- Enhanced Control: A console typically houses the steering wheel, throttle, and instrument gauges, providing better maneuverability and control over the boat.
- Improved Comfort: Consoles often include storage compartments and windshields, protecting the driver from wind and elements.
- Customization Options: With a console, you can add electronics such as GPS, fish finders, and radios, which elevates your boating experience.
- Increased Safety: Having controls centralized in a console allows for smoother handling, essential in rough waters or when navigating narrow channels.

Key Features to Look for When Buying Jon Boat Plans with Console
Not all jon boat plans are created equal. To maximize your investment, consider these key features before purchasing:
Material Compatibility
Some plans are designed specifically for wood, aluminum, or fiberglass. If you prefer an aluminum jon boat due to its lightweight and rust-resistant properties, make sure the plans cater to aluminum construction. This affects the tools required and the assembly techniques.
Console Design and Layout
Look for plans that offer a console design matching your preferences, whether it’s a simple steering console or one with advanced instrument panels. The layout should allow easy access to controls without obstructing movement inside the boat.
Detailed Instructions and Support
Plans with clear instructions, illustrations, and possibly video tutorials or builder support forums provide a smoother building experience. Some sellers offer customer support to answer questions during your build.
Boat Size and Capacity
Ensure the plans specify the boat’s dimensions and weight capacity to match your intended use. The size impacts transportation, storage, and the type of motor you can install.
Customization Flexibility
Plans that encourage or allow for customization enable you to tailor the boat to your specific needs, such as adding extra storage, rod holders, or a live well.

Step-by-Step Guide to Building Your Jon Boat with Console
Once you have purchased your jon boat plans with console, follow this general process to ensure a successful build:
1. Gather Materials and Tools
Based on the material list, purchase aluminum sheets (or the materials specified), rivets, welding equipment (if applicable), sealants, paint, and hardware. Also, ensure you have basic tools such as drills, saws, rivet guns, and safety gear.
2. Prepare Your Workspace
Set up a clean, well-lit workspace with enough room to lay out materials and assemble components. A flat surface is ideal for accurate measurements and assembly.
3. Cut and Shape the Aluminum Panels
Using the provided templates and measurements, cut the aluminum sheets carefully. Follow instructions for shaping the hull, bow, transom, and floor panels.
4. Assemble the Hull
Begin joining the panels as per the steps, securing them with rivets and welding if needed. Pay close attention to alignment and sealing joints to ensure watertightness.
5. Construct the Console
Build the console frame using the specified materials and dimensions. Install steering components like the wheel, cables, and throttle controls as detailed in the plans.
6. Install the Deck and Seating
Attach the deck panels and seats, ensuring stability and comfort. Some plans include storage compartments integrated into the seats or console.
7. Apply Finishing Touches
Sand sharp edges, apply protective coatings, and paint your jon boat. Add any custom features such as rod holders, cleats, or electronics.
8. Test and Launch
Before heading out, inspect your boat thoroughly for leaks or loose components. Conduct a float test in shallow water to confirm stability and performance.
Benefits of Using Aluminum Jon Boat Plans with Console
Choosing aluminum plans with console offers numerous benefits:
- Durability: Aluminum is resistant to rust, corrosion, and dents, ensuring a longer lifespan.
- Lightweight: Easier to transport and launch compared to heavier wooden or fiberglass boats.
- Low Maintenance: Requires minimal upkeep, saving time and money.
- Customizability: Aluminum sheets are easier to cut and shape, allowing for design modifications.
